Ballast Water Management

Ballast water is a very important liquid in the ship. This is used to stabilize and balance the movement of the ship, especially during the operations of loading and unloading. Therefore, effective management of ballast water is crucial. This will help the ship in maintaining the vessel’s safety and stability. You can definitely invest in PP FRP tanks because of their rigidity and strength as the tank’s reinforced plastic construction allows them to operate the weight of the ballast water without failing or any damage. In addition, these tanks can undergo exposure to saline ballast water without suffering from corrosion. This quality of PP FRP storage tanks makes it different from others. You can definitely invest in these tanks as it minimizes the risk of structural failure during motion.

Bilge Water Storage

While traveling in a ship, different types of liquid need to be stored, one of which is Bilge water. Bilge water is an important part of the ship which accumulates in the lowest part of the ship and needs special attention as well. This is because it will prevent environmental contamination and make sure that the vessel is safe. Bilge water contains oil and other contaminants, therefore, it is important to go for PP FRP tanks as it can handle the corrosive nature of bilge water. Not only this, the structure and design of PP FRP tanks helps prevent spills and leaks. This makes the handling task much easier. The use of the right tank here can enhance the productivity of the operation.

Cooling Water Storage

You must be wondering why we need to store cooling water on the ship? This is because cooling systems are used for managing the temperature of the machines and engine on a ship. Here, PP FRP tanks can be used for storing cooling water because of its thermal stability. This means that the tank will remain in its shape and structure even when storing cooling water at any temperature. In addition, the tank is resistant to corrosion, which ensures that the cooling water will remain pure.  So, use PP FRP tanks to remain functional over time and for the overall operational efficiency of the vessel.

Lubricant Storage

Engineers use lubricants for maintaining the engines and machinery on the ships. This is the reason why lubricants play a crucial role during long sea journeys. Here, storing the lubricant properly becomes an important task for preventing it from pollution and ensuring effectiveness. Storing these lubricants in PP FRP tanks is an excellent option because this tank can handle a range of lubricants without reacting or deteriorating with the content. This will ensure that the lubricant is effective and no harm is done. In addition, the structural integrity of PP FRP tanks can support the weight of the lubricant without mutilation. Wastewater Holding

Discussed less, but this is one of the most important tasks that needs to be performed to keep the environment and the ship clean. The ship needs to manage wastewater effectively to meet the environmental regulations. You can opt for PP FRP tanks to store the wastewater. It has a smooth surface which makes the cleaning and maintaining process easier. In addition, as we have talked about, these tanks are corrosion resistant, which means it can handle the alkaline and acidic components of water waste without deteriorating. This helps the ships in treating and managing waste easily, which ultimately contributes to environmental protection.
